The Netherlands had a electronic waste recycling rate of 41 percent in 2018. Specifically the EU target is that by 2021 member states will collect 65 percent of the average weight of electrical and electronic equipment. The European Waste Electrical and Electronic Equipment Directive Directive classifies waste in ten categories.

40000 tonnes of household electronic waste is incinerated annually in the Netherlands.
